探寻前端开发中,中级与初级工程师的分水岭


在前端开发的职业道路上,每一位工程师都会经历从初级到中级,乃至高级的成长过程,这一路上,技能的提升、知识的累积以及思维模式的转变都是不可或缺的,对于众多正在这条路上探索的前端开发者而言,前端中级和初级的分水岭究竟在哪里? 简而言之,这一分水岭主要体现在技术深度与广度、问题解决能力、项目经验及职业素养四个维度上。

前端中级和初级的分水岭在哪里?

技术深度与广度来看,初级前端工程师往往聚焦于基础语法的学习与简单页面的实现,如HTML、CSS布局及JavaScript基础应用,而中级工程师则在此基础上,深入理解并掌握更复杂的框架(如React、Vue或Angular)及其生态系统,能够高效利用这些工具解决实际问题,同时对前端工程化、性能优化、安全防护等方面有较为深刻的认识和实践经验,他们不仅知道如何做,更明白为何这样做,以及不同方案之间的优劣对比。

问题解决能力方面,初级工程师可能更多地依赖于查找现有代码示例或文档来解决问题,面对复杂问题时容易感到手足无措,相比之下,中级工程师具备更强的逻辑思维和问题抽象能力,能够独立分析问题根源,设计并实施有效的解决方案,他们懂得如何利用调试工具高效定位问题,也善于从失败中学习,不断优化自己的解决策略。

项目经验是区分两者的重要标志,初级工程师可能参与过一些小型项目,但往往局限于完成指定任务,缺乏全局视角,中级工程师则通常有多个中大型项目的实战经验,能够从需求分析、架构设计到开发部署全程参与,甚至在某些项目中担任核心开发角色,这些经验使他们能够更好地理解业务需求,预见潜在的技术挑战,并提出前瞻性的解决方案。

职业素养的提升也是中级工程师区别于初级的关键,这包括良好的代码习惯(如代码规范、注释清晰)、团队协作能力、持续学习的态度以及自我驱动的职业发展规划,中级工程师懂得如何高效沟通,能够在团队中发挥积极作用,同时也更加注重个人品牌的建立,通过技术博客、开源项目等方式分享知识,扩大影响力。

前端中级与初级工程师之间的分水岭并非一蹴而就,而是技术、思维、经验及职业素养等多方面因素共同作用的结果,对于每一位渴望进阶的前端开发者来说,持续学习、勇于实践、不断反思,是跨越这一分水岭,迈向更高层次的不二法门。

未经允许不得转载! 作者:HTML前端知识网,转载或复制请以超链接形式并注明出处HTML前端知识网

原文地址:https://www.html4.cn/4636.html发布于:2026-06-18